WebIn Denmark, it has long been standard practice that the days off employees earned during one calendar year were used during the following ‘holiday year’ (starting the 1st of May and ending on the 30th of April). Changes to the Danish Holiday Act that came into effect on the 1st of September 2024 mean a new way of earning and using days off.
